*** CHEMICAL IDENTIFICATION ***
RTECS NUMBER : GU8632000
CHEMICAL NAME : Cyclohexanecarboxylic acid, 2-phenyl-,
2-diethylaminoethyl ester, hydrochloride
LAST UPDATED : 199506
DATA ITEMS CITED : 15
MOLECULAR FORMULA : C19-H29-N-O2.Cl-H
MOLECULAR WEIGHT : 339.95
COMPOUND DESCRIPTOR : Drug
SYNONYMS/TRADE NAMES :
* beta-Diethylaminoethyl-2-phenylhexahydrobenzoate hydrochloride
* 2-Phenylcyclohexanecarboxylic acid 2-diethylaminoethyl ester
hydrochloride
* S 190
*** HEALTH HAZARD DATA ***
** ACUTE TOXICITY DATA **
TYPE OF TEST : LDLo - Lowest published lethal dose
ROUTE OF EXPOSURE : Oral
SPECIES OBSERVED : Rodent - rat
DOSE/DURATION : 1600 mg/kg
TOXIC EFFECTS :
Behavioral - muscle contraction or spasticity
Lungs, Thorax, or Respiration - dyspnea
Gastrointestinal - ulceration or bleeding from stomach
REFERENCE :
APPNAH Acta Physiologica et Pharmacologica Neerlandica. (Amsterdam,
Netherlands) V.1-15, 1950-69. For publisher information, see EJPHAZ.
Volume(issue)/page/year: 1,4,1950
